English

We will continue to use The Power of Reading modules for our Literacy planning.  In the first half term, we will be reading The Green Ship by Quentin Blake and writing a letter, dairy entry and instructions. In the second half term, our focus moves to an environmental story called The Promise by Nicola Davies where we will be writing an explanation text and creating poetry. Later in the second half term, we will focus our writing on a persuasive letter about Cheltenham using our geographical knowledge.

Guided Reading and Home Reading

Guided reading will continue to be taught each day using fiction and non-fiction texts. Please continue to read with your child at home. Afterwards ask some ‘how’ or ‘why’ questions to help with their understanding. Once your child is a fluent reader, begin to talk about why the writer has chosen particular words, sentences or text features and the effect these features have on the reader. There are some guidance notes in the back pages of the reading scheme books, which you may find helpful.

Spelling

Spelling will be taught during our English lessons. Weekly spelling homework will be published on Microsoft Teams each week. It is important to practise these spellings at home, as they form part of the statutory list of Year 3 spellings that children are expected to know.

Science

This term’s science unit will be Plants. In this unit, the children will be learning about the different functions of plants, what different plants need to grow and seed dispersal.
